MODERN METHODS OF SMOOTH STARTING OF ASYNCHRONOUS MOTORS: THEIR TECHNOLOGIES AND INDUSTRIAL APPLICATIONS

This article analyzes modern methods for the smooth starting of asynchronous motors. The problems that arise during the startup process of asynchronous motors and various effective methods to address them are discussed in detail, including soft starters, star-delta control, inverter-based control, and other technologies. The advantages, disadvantages, and industrial applications of each method are explained, along with the conditions and systems where they are most effective. Modern control systems and intelligent technologies are examined for their role in increasing motor efficiency, ensuring stable power supply, and optimizing production processes. The article provides important recommendations for optimizing asynchronous motors in various industrial sectors, contributing to energy efficiency, safety, and the long-term operation of equipment. This study serves as a valuable resource for implementing advanced technologies in asynchronous motor control.
